The length of time does it take to get a Belgian driver's license?
The time it takes can vary depending upon the individual. The theoretical test can typically be taken within a couple of weeks, while practical lessons and tests can take a number of months to finish.
2. Is it possible to drive in Belgium with a foreign license?
Yes, immigrants can drive in Belgium with a legitimate worldwide or nationwide driver's license for a limited duration. However, if you become a local, you might need to exchange it for a Belgian license.
3. Can I take the theoretical test in English?
Yes, the theoretical exam is readily available in a number of languages, including English, Dutch, French, and German.
4. What occurs if I stop working the useful driving test?
You can retake the test after a waiting duration of 14 days. It is advisable to take additional driving lessons before trying the test once again.
5. Can I drive previously getting my complete license?
Yes, you can drive with a provisionary license (or student's permit) after passing the theoretical exam, however you need to be accompanied by a licensed motorist.
